Transaction 68138a62fc36290a286e309ac4cb77deee5371161fd53319e7f043c3527d7a9d

1 Input
2 Outputs
  • 68138a62fc36290a286e309ac4cb77deee5371161fd53319e7f043c3527d7a9d:0
  • value  40705
    address  16K8Hcfp7AXQvCNgduBrqeagXnAdGWoMZ4
  • 68138a62fc36290a286e309ac4cb77deee5371161fd53319e7f043c3527d7a9d:1
  • value  1046935
    address  1691wKX7mGC3BFSpxQZUNb6BX3xUhCscnR